Staff, students and guests of the School of Music discuss topical issues in music history and criticism, as well as their latest research. Every other Wednesday, at 5.30pm, in the Music Theatre; followed by a chance to talk with event attendees at an informal reception held in the Music Theatre foyer.
Aidan Lang has worked as an opera director for the past 30 years. He has held the position of Director of Productions at Glyndebourne Touring Opera, Artistic Director of Opera Zuid in the Netherlands and the Buxton Festival, and he is currently General Director of the NBR New Zealand Opera.
"Scarpia’s plastic fish"
Mr Lang will discuss the elaborate process of staging an opera, drawing on his experiences from around the world, including the Topkapi Palace in Istanbul, a country house in Oxfordshire and the Amazon rainforest.
